Cream of Crap Soup Extraordinary

"This is a tribute to Mean Chef. This soup is originally titled California Cream Soup from a Betty Crocker book in the 60's. It is surprisingly light and fresh tasting, attractive, and quite good, actually."

ingredients

  • 1 (10 1/2 ounce) can cream of celery soup
  • 1 (10 1/2 ounce) can cream of chicken soup
  • 2 cups milk
  • 23 cup light cream (20%)
  • 34 teaspoon salt
  • 18 teaspoon pepper
  • 1 medium ripe avocado, peeled and chopped
  • 14 cup olive (sliced, pitted, and use a combo of green and black)
  • 14 cup chopped pimiento

directions

  • Combine soups, milk, cream, salt and pepper;heat to simmering over low heat, stirring occasionally.
  • Stir in avocado, olives, and pimiento; heat through.
